SkyHouse is in the Ground

SkyHouse Houston is officially in progresswe stopped by the groundbreaking last week to snag the shovel shot. Novare Group prez Jim Borders (dead center) says the project may have set a record for pre-developmentits been in the works for seven years. The 336-unit community will deliver in one year, an unheard-of speed. You can read more about the project here. (Our question is: Is there an Island of Forgotten Ceremonial Shovels?)
